arcattackandClaude Fable 5 5ba5697a08 Fix glass panel dead-button crash: null-init MessageHandlerSet gap slots (Gitea #18)
Clicking a per-display glass Engineering panel button (0x21 on an Eng page)
hard-crashed via a wild call through an uninitialised pointer (eip=cdcdcdcd
debug / 0x01048748 release), zero btl4 frames above Receiver::Receive.

Root cause is the dense message-handler-table gap hazard (reconstruction-
gotchas #11), the message-side twin of the attribute-table one -- NOT a /FORCE
unresolved external (the glass link log carried only the known-benign mech3.obj
CreateStreamedSubsystem set). Receiver::MessageHandlerSet::Find(id) returns
messageHandlers[id-1].entryHandler for any id <= entryCount with no populated-
check, and Receive() calls it when != NullHandler. The streamed Eng-page .CTL
dispatches subsystem msg id 3/0xb to whatever subsystem is shown; a weapon
(Emitter) registers only PoweredSubsystem 4-8 + MechWeapon 9-10, so id 3 is a
gap below entryCount 10. Build did new HandlerEntry[entryCount] and left gaps
uninitialised -> (this->*garbage)(msg). The 1995 binary has the identical non-
zeroing new[] (part_002.c Build) and survived only on fresh-heap-zero luck: a
weapon receiving id 3 was always meant to IGNORE it (id 3 = a Condenser/
Reservoir action in a different subsystem branch; the uniform Eng-page button
template makes buttons for unimplemented actions authentically inert). The new
per-display windows just made the id reachable live.

Fix (engine, class-wide, faithful): Build now null-inits every slot
(entryID=0/entryName=""/entryHandler=NullHandler) before copying inherited /
placing supplied, so a gap is deterministically NullHandler -> Receive drops it
(the authentic "Receiver ignores unhandled messages"), with an empty never-NULL
name so the name-based Find() strcmp can't deref a gap. Correct dispatch
contract, not a glass-path guard -> protects the whole dead-button class (#14).

Also lands the [glasswin] CLICK crash-forensics log (names the button before
dispatch).

Verified under cdb: click-soaked every MFD bank (Engineering/L+R Weapons/Heat/
Comm, ~130 clicks through Quad<->Eng page cycles) -> zero AVs, reconstructed
mapper preset selects still fire ([mode] preset (1,1)/(2,1)...); pod build +
solo mission un-regressed.

CydandClaude Opus 4.8 f338595685 Glass cockpit: per-display windows (BT_GLASS_PANELS)
Break the desktop glass cockpit's secondary displays out of the single
combined pad panel + D3D gauge strip into ONE window per pod display, each
carrying that display's surface with its RIO button bank, arranged
pod-faithfully around the main view.  New TU engine/MUNGA_L4/L4GLASSWIN.*
(BT_GLASS-only), selected by the -platform glass preset via the new runtime
gate BT_GLASS_PANELS (=0 falls back to the legacy single panel + dock).

- Surfaces are CPU-expanded from the shared gauge buffer
  (SVGA16::ExpandPlaneToBGRA, no D3D) and StretchDIBits'd in -- the D3D
  dev-composite path (dock / window / overlay) stands down while active.
- Buttons sit UNDER the imagery: big hidden click targets that reach into
  the display, with only a small protruding edge showing as a lamp light.
  Red MFD banks tile the top/bottom; radar rails run the sides + a bottom
  row; a Flight Controls window hosts the no-display banks.
- Windows: Heat / Engineering / Comm / Left Weapons / Right Weapons / radar
  + Flight Controls; edge-to-edge (no in-client margin/title; OS caption
  labels each).
- Fix blank surfaces: application/ghWnd are duplicate-defined and bind
  non-deterministically under /FORCE, so the fresh L4GLASSWIN TU read NULL.
  Reach the renderer/window via BTResolveGaugeRenderer/BTResolveMainWindow
  defined in btl4main.cpp off the real btl4App/hWnd pointers.  New gotcha:
  reconstruction-gotchas.md S6 duplicate-GLOBAL corollary.
